Sarkozy: Credit rating agencies should not define
Madrid, 17 Jan (EFE).- French president Nicolas Sarkozy expressed his disapproval of credit rating agencies ability to define a country's economic policy and has called for an 'cold-blooded' analysis of their decisions. The French head of state made these comments at a press conference with Spanish prime minister Mariano Rajoy on Monday.
